how much hp it will take safely i assume? you can stick 40lb of boost through it if you want, just can't see the engine lasting that long.
Every new build has an element of risk. you could push 500bhp out of a fully forged engine and run it all day with no probs. you could have a 400bhp engine that would **** itself after 1000 miles. how long is a piece of string, there are so many variables here, we can only give you anecdotal evidence of what we have done, what has worked for us, what has not worked for us. best we can give you is a ball park figure but that is no guaruntee.
